New York's Dragonfly Concept

In the race to insure food for ever-larger urban populations, designers and architects are working on vertical farms inside cities.

As I have written about both Vancouver's Harvest Tower and Dubai's Food City, New York City is looking to join the club in a big way.

Vincent Callebaut Architectures
has designed the Dragonfly building, based on two vertical towers. According to World Architectural News and Fast Company.com:

"Callebaut's 132 floor, 600-meter-high farm contains 28 different agricultural fields for fruit, vegetable, meat and dairy production. The fields are surrounded by houses, offices, and research laboratories laid out over several floors. The building, which is completely powered by solar and wind power, also purifies liquid waste into water suitable for crops and composts solid waste for fertilizers."

Although there isn't sufficient surface area for a traditional green roof, the benefits of a green roof are captured in the grey water recycling as well as the CO2 reduction by the plant life.

The core of the building is a greenhouse, in the shape of a dragonfly's wing. This core supports the weight of the building and allows sunlight to pass through the building.

The significance of urban farming is to provide sufficient agricultural goods to the city while limiting the shipping traffic traditionally associated with feeding it. There is an opinion that reducing the need for rural farm land will allow that land to revert to its original state.

While it is clear that the Dragonfly concept isn't capable of being built today, the concepts included in the design can influence future buildings.

Food in the City

Vancouver seeks to been one of the greenest and sustainable cities in the world. To help reach their goal, they held the FormShift Vancouver Competition, and Harvest Tower won an Honorable Mention.

Inhabitat.com reports that this new complex, a tower, green roofs, and grazing area, "... consists of interlocking tubes that grow various fruits and vegetables, house chickens and contain an aquaponic fish farm." Hydroponic garden

While this is more ambitious than Los Angeles's edible green roof, it is in the same league as Dubai's Food City. Vancouver also boasts Canada's largest green roof.

Other agricultural products include, "... a livestock grazing plain, as well as a bird habitat and boutique sheep and goat dairy facility." There will also be a restaurant, and grocery store.

Sustainability is also important in this project, through the use of wind turbines, photovalic glazing, and methane captured from composting. I think composting is a euphemism for manure. Water will be provided by a large rain cistern on the roof. Water Barrels and Storage The green roofs will also provide filtration, mitigate storm water runoff and reduce air pollution.

While vertical farming is being studied elsewhere by "...Dr. Dickson Despommier, an environmental health scientist at Columbia University, his work reveals that for every one acre of indoor farming, four to six acres of outdoor land can be saved." While farming in the city keeps the food local and reduces transport pollution, the once-farmed land can be returned to natural habitats.

Dubai's Food City

As I have written about both Abu Dhabi's green roofs, and Los Angeles's edible green roof, Dubai has outdone both.

Inhabitat.com reports that Dubai, in coordination with green landscaping firm, GCLA, are going to build a "Food City," complete "...off-the-grid, self-sufficient metropolis." Taste the Purest Tea on the Planet – Organic and Fair Trade Certified Shop Numi Organic Tea

How does one do that in Dubai, one of driest climates on earth? The answer (starting with green roofs!):

"...atmospheric water harvesting, solar desalination through concentrated solar collectors, grey water recycling, and application of hydroponic sand to minimize water loss."

All of this requires significant electricity, which will done via solar collectors focused on towers. Water Barrels and Storage

I wish Dubai luck, though I feel the project may be a bit ambitious.
